#9f7860 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#9f7860 is composed of 62.4% red, 47.1%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 24.5% magenta, 39.6% yellow and 37.6% black. It has a hue angle of 22.9 degrees, a saturation of 24.7% and a lightness of 50%. #9f7860 color hex could be obtained by blending #fff0c0 with #3f0000. Closest websafe color is: #996666.

#9f7860 color description : Mostly desaturated dark orange.

#9f7860 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#9f7860 has RGB values of R:159, G:120, B:96 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.25, Y:0.4, K:0.38. Its decimal value is 10451040.

Shades and Tints of #9f7860

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c0907 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.
